  5. What is thermal runaway? CAUSED BY  Excess of battery charging current  Produces more internal heat than the battery can dissipate Thermal runaway can be detected , prevented and recovered from 5

  8. The monster appears unexpectedly?  There is ALWAYS an early warning  We just did not understand the signals • They are obvious • There for many months! 8

  9. What are these early warning signs?  Increase in float current • Starts very slowly • Increases over time • Current through the battery • Not necessarily = charger meter 9

  11. What are these early warning signs?  Increase in float current  Gradual increase in the temperature • Starts very slowly differential between • Increases over time cells and ambient • Current through the battery These two items – when properly checked and tracked – will provide substantial warning so that you can take necessary actions to prevent a thermal runaway 11

  12. What causes thermal runaway?  Negative plate discharge and sulfation  Increase in float current  Dry out of cells  Loss of electrolyte contact through AGM from plate to plate = inability of cells to dissipate internally generated excess heat 12

  13. Preventing thermal runaway  IEEE 1188 standard  Maintain overall float voltage correct for ambient temperature  Track temp. differential between cells and ambient monthly  Track float current monthly Contact us for guidance on what “typical” float current should be for your battery 13

  14. How to take the measurements  Hand held meters  Monitoring, such as the BEM device  Keep accurate records and keep track of records Track readings for the life of the battery 14

  15. Recovery after thermal runaway  Re ‐ establish proper saturation  Remove sulfates from the negative plates  Install catalysts You can take a structurally intact battery from full ‐ blown thermal runaway and turn it back into a usable and reliable battery 15
